x ■ Safety Precautions Do not damage the AC cable. Use only specified AC cables and connector cables. Use this scanner only at the indicated power voltage. Do not connect to multiple-power strips. Do not touch the AC cable with wet hands. Wipe any dust fr om the power plug.
Network Scanner fi-6000NS Getting Started xi Do not install the sc anner on unstable surfaces. Do not block the ventilation ports. Do not place heavy objects or climb on top of the scanner . Firmly insert the power plug. A void any contact when scanner is in use.

4 Chapter 2 Setting up the Scanner 2.1 Space Requirements The following space is requir ed to set up the scanner: Depth: 700m m Width: 400mm Height: 500mm 2.2 Installing the Scanner 1. Place the scanner at its installation sit e. 2. Attach the ADF paper chute.

14 Appendix B Scanner Care ■ Cleaning Materials * To obtain Cleaner F1 , contact your FUJITSU dealer or an authorized FUJITSU scanner service provider. ■ Cleaning Method Clean the ADF with a soft cloth moistened with cleaner F1. ■ Which Parts and When Clean all parts after every 1,000 sheets scanned.
